When Petra and Natividad Estudillo opened Las Cuatro Milpas in 1933, they couldn't have known that their small Mexican restaurant would make it into the 21st century. But with simple, good food and efficient, friendly service, the restaurant has excelled ever since.

The home made tortillas are incredible, and Las Cuatro Milpas also has a lot of history as well, seeing as they were the first restaurant in San Diego to serve fast-food Mexican fare.
